Acessando funções de loop (por exemplo, the_title ou the_content) de ID de postagem

Eu tenho uma série de IDs de postagem obtidos através de um código de filtragem complicado. Eu quero exibir postagens dessas IDs e, para cada publicação, preciso acessar funções de postagem regulares como the_title e tal. Mais importante ainda, para cada publicação, preciso recuperar valores de campos personalizados (e, ainda mais precisamente, preciso de valores de campos de “relacionamento” criados com o complemento Advanced Custom Fields).

Existe uma maneira de acessar funções de postagem regulares de qualquer lugar simplesmente com base em IDs de postagem, como se eu estivesse dentro do loop regular?

Solutions Collecting From Web of "Acessando funções de loop (por exemplo, the_title ou the_content) de ID de postagem"

Você pode usar o get_post para obter os objects de publicação de uma determinada postagem.

Isso será objects não filtrados, então você gostaria de usar os filtros de apply_filters e os filtros apropriados descritos na página vinculada.

Se você precisa obter informações de um campo personalizado, sejam campos personalizados nativos de campos ACF, você pode simplesmente adicionar a ID para o get_post_meta para campos personalizados nativos ou get_field funções get_field ou get_field no ACF.

Lembre-se, por padrão, o post ID da postagem atual, mas você pode alterar isso para qualquer ID de publicação da qual você deseja obter informações